Job Description
The Nephrology Division of the Department of Medicine at the Larner College of Medicine, University of Vermont and University of Vermont Medical Center seeks a full-time faculty member at the Assistant/Associate Professor level on the Clinical Scholar Pathway. Faculty rank at appointment is to be determined by experience. The successful candidate will have experience in both the regulatory side of dialysis, including home dialysis, and the clinical management of patients in all stages of chronic kidney disease. Prior experience as a dialysis Medical Director is highly desired. The candidate must hold an MD or equivalent degree and must be Board Certified/Eligible in Internal Medicine and Nephrology.
